Yes, I do use them. I use 2 or 3, depending on where I am going to be sewing. I really like them. It makes the sewing go along faster, because you can just take off the bottom clip and move it above the others and keep sewing. Easier on my hands, too, with my arthritis.

I use them all the time, the really big clips are perfect to hold a quilt rolled so you can quilt the center.
I roll the quilt from both sides, clip a lot, & now it is very managable, easy to unclip to move to the next area.
